Windows gets targeted simply because of its wide target audience. If the whole world used Mac OS (*shudder*) it would get targeted in the same manner. In fact, a trojan aimed exclusively at the Mac was released lately.

Mac OSX is built on a modified version of the BSD kernel and, with it, comes some absolutely crippling security flaws and bugs. Believe me, you are not safe regardless of what you use. No operating system is impenentrable, it just takes those in the know a certain period of time in which to find the flaws.
